One of my favorite things to do, is make paper flowers and use them on cards. I don't use them on every card...guess that would get old after awhile...not to mention, making them different since I suck at arranging them would be hard for me to do...but I do have fun with them when I can.

I got several dies for my birthday this month from Cherry Lynn Designs, and used several on this card along with a wood grain embossing folder from Sizzix.  The dies I used were: Sunflower, barbed wire, tiny fanciful flourish & mini butterflies.  I got lazy, so instead of cutting the middle of the sunflower out of brown cardstock, I just colored the yellow one brown with a bic marker, it seemed to work quite well.
